Exploration of the Research Projects and Initiatives Undertaken by the UC Davis Computer Science Department

The UC Davis computer science department is actively engaged in research projects in a variety of areas. These include artificial intelligence, machine learning, robotics, natural language processing, computer vision, cybersecurity, and more. The department also works closely with other departments at the university, such as the College of Engineering, to collaborate on research initiatives.

Overview of the Courses Offered in the UC Davis Computer Science Department

The UC Davis computer science department offers a wide range of courses, including core courses and electives. Core courses include software engineering, algorithms and data structures, programming languages, and computer systems. Elective courses cover topics such as game design, artificial intelligence, machine learning, and web development.
